President and Founder of the Angel Group of Companies, Dr. Kwaku Oteng, says he pays as many as 5,000 workers employed under his company.

He indicated that these number of employees are on payrolls and received monthly salaries from their services rendered to him.

Angel Group of Companies has the Angel Broadcasting Network (ABN) as its conglomerate with over 19 radio stations spread across the 16 regions, with two digital television stations including Angel TV and One HD TV and an online platform, Angelonline.com.gh.

It is also the producer of Adonko Bitters, Adonko Two Fingers, among other alcoholic beverages.

Dr. Oteng, financier of these companies said he managed to respectively reward each worker with what is due them on monthly basis.

“The employees I pay are countless. If you put them together, the total reaches 5,000 monthly. That is why your salaries are sometimes delayed,” he said.

“I know you, the employees, have expressed displeasure about this situation, but I plead with you to pardon me because I always try to ensure every worker gets paid,” the businessman stated.

He added “Though things sometimes become difficult, God miraculously shows me the way in such circumstances.

That is why, in my 25 to 30 years of working experience with my employees, no one can ever claim to have been unpaid for a month,” Dr. Kwaku Oteng stressed further on the Angel Morning Show (AMS), Monday, February 17, 2025.
